In this second edition of How to Run Reflective Practice Groups: The Heads and Hearts Model for Healthcare Professionals Arabella Kurtz provides a comprehensive guide to the facilitation of reflective practice groups with the aim of demystifying reflective practice and providing structure and purpose.

Responding to the rapidly increasing demand for reflective practice groups in healthcare and drawing on her extensive experience as a facilitator and trainer, Kurtz presents a fully developed, eight-stage model: The Heads and Hearts Model of Reflective Practice Groups. The book offers a guide to the organisation, structure and delivery of group sessions, with useful suggestions for overcoming commonly encountered problems and promoting empathic relationships with clients and colleagues. The second edition has been enlarged and updated, with new chapters on the role of the facilitator and management of group dynamics, what can be learnt from research in the area, and adaptations of the model for brief, responsive reflective practice and the facilitation of groups online.

Clearly and accessibly written, using full situational examples for each stage of the presented model, How to Run Reflective Practice Groups offers a comprehensive guide to facilitating reflective practice for any healthcare professional.
